Hurlers from across Ulster nominated for the 2019 Champion 15 Team

Hurlers from across Ulster are in the running for the 2019 Champion 15 Team based on their outstanding performances in this year’s Ring, Rackard and Meagher Hurling Championships.

The Champion 15 selection will be awarded as part of the PwC All-Stars event in Dublin’s Convention Centre on Friday 1st November.

In all 15 Ulster players feature on the list of 45 nominees.

Beaten Christy Ring finalists Down have four nominees while Armagh are well represented with three nominees following their Nicky Rackard campaign.

The list also includes two players from Derry, two from Tyrone and one player from counties Cavan, Donegal, Fermanagh and Monaghan.

This is the first year that a selection of 45 players has been chosen from the Ring, Rackard and Meagher competitions. The new selection process has introduced player and coach feedback and has been finalised by an independent selection committee of journalists and referees. Players competing in the Joe McDonagh Cup were considered in the PwC All-Stars for the Liam MacCarthy.
